2 Brakes Failed problem of the 2016 Mazda CX-5

Failure Date: 09/15/2020

Tl the contact owns a 2016 Mazda cx5. The contact stated that the parking brake inadvertently engaged while driving at various speeds without warning. While driving, the contact suspected that the parking brake was still engaged. The contact exited the vehicle and smelled a burning odor coming from the rear wheels. The contact then took the vehicle to an independent mechanic who also noticed the same failure with the parking brake while driving the vehicle. The vehicle was then repaired by the independent mechanic for the parking brake failure. The manufacturer was not notified of the failure. The failure mileage was 48,784.

5 Brakes Failed problem of the 2016 Mazda CX-5

Failure Date: 11/17/2016

Electronic parking brake stays engaged while driving causing brakes excessive wear and brake failure. Five 2016 cx5 vehicles manufactured in same 5 month period came to dealership with same problem. Problem first detected by squeaking. Problem gets worse until difficult to stop when braking. Grumbling noise in front caused by bad bearings. Providing dealer records and parts that have been ordered. Concerned that Mazda has not addressed this issue which may not manifest itself for a year or more after purchase. Mazda is still selling the 2016 models since the 2017's have been delayed. Mazda has had rear brake problems in its previous models of cx5 but does not address issues on the 2016. Concerned that someone may be seriously hurt or killed by this braking issue. Car has been in service since November 17 2016 because suitable parts are still on order. Worried that with time parts will deteriorate again. Please see part number of the epb unit still outstanding on attachment.
